How Long Does Overseas IVF Take?

A complete overseas IVF cycle, from starting the examinations to confirming pregnancy, takes a minimum of about 10 weeks and can take up to 6 months or more. The key variables affecting the total duration include:

  • Speed of completing preliminary examinations (Chromosomal karyotyping takes 15–30 days)
  • Ovarian stimulation protocol (Conventional protocol: 10–14 days; Luteal phase or PPOS protocols may vary slightly)
  • Whether PGT is performed (Preimplantation Genetic Testing requires an additional 2–4 weeks)
  • Transfer strategy (Fresh transfer vs. frozen embryo transfer; frozen transfer requires a 1–2 month menstrual cycle interval)
  • Destination country visa and stay duration (Some countries may require multiple trips)

Four-Stage Timeline Breakdown

The medical process of overseas IVF can be summarized into four consecutive stages, with the following time windows for each stage:

Stage Core Content Estimated Duration
Stage 1
Preliminary Preparation
Basic fertility assessment (AMH, FSH, LH, E2, antral follicle count), semen analysis, chromosomal testing, infectious disease screening, genetic counseling, passport and visa application 4–8 weeks
Stage 2
Ovarian Stimulation & Egg Retrieval
Start stimulation on day 2–3 of menstruation, monitor follicles every 2–4 days, egg retrieval 36 hours after trigger 12–16 days
Stage 3
Embryo Culture & Testing
Fertilization (IVF/ICSI), blastocyst culture (5–6 days), PGT biopsy and genetic testing (takes 2–4 weeks), cryopreservation 3–6 weeks
Stage 4
Transfer & Luteal Support
Endometrial preparation (natural or artificial cycle), embryo transfer, luteal support medication, pregnancy test 12–14 days after transfer 3–5 weeks

Note: If using frozen embryo transfer, there may be a 1–2 month menstrual cycle interval between Stage 3 and Stage 4 for endometrial preparation.

Most Easily Overlooked Details

In timeline planning, the following points are often underestimated or missed:

  • Time to receive chromosomal karyotyping report: Conventional culture method takes 15–30 days. If a sample needs to be recollected or culture fails, the cycle will be extended.
  • PGT testing cycle: After blastocyst biopsy, it takes 2–4 weeks to get results, and you need to confirm the testing platform (NGS or aCGH) with the lab in advance.
  • Passport validity: Most countries require a passport valid for more than 6 months, and visa processing should be reserved 2–4 weeks in advance.
  • Validity of male semen analysis: Semen analysis results are usually valid for 6–12 months, but for sperm DNA fragmentation testing, some labs require strict control of abstinence time.
  • Previous surgical history or uterine issues: If a hysteroscopy or polypectomy is needed, 1–2 menstrual cycles of recovery are required before transfer.

Most Common Pitfalls

Based on real case feedback, the following four areas are the highest risk in timeline planning:

  • Too tight a connection between examinations and stimulation: Some clinics require all reports to be complete before filing and starting. If the chromosomal report is delayed, you may miss the current cycle start.
  • Choosing the wrong visa type: Some countries’ medical visas allow a stay of 30–60 days, but if multiple trips are needed (e.g., separate egg retrieval and transfer), visa terms must be confirmed in advance.
  • Mismatch between endometrial preparation plan and embryo testing time: If PGT results are not ready when the endometrium enters the transfer window, it may lead to cycle cancellation or additional medication.
  • Ignoring time zone differences and drug storage conditions: Stimulation medications require cold chain transport at 2–8°C. When carrying them across borders, customs regulations and temperature control during transit must be confirmed.

Time Differences Between Countries

The medical system, lab scheduling, and visa policies of the destination country affect the total duration:

Country / Region Typical Cycle Duration Main Influencing Factors
Thailand 2.5–4 months Fast examination process, shorter PGT testing cycle, flexible visa stay
United States 3–6 months Longer PGT testing time (2–4 weeks), some clinics have a waiting list to start a cycle
Malaysia 2–4 months High examination efficiency, medical visa processing takes about 2 weeks
Japan 3–5 months High frequency of staged visits, requiring multiple trips to Japan, shorter single stay
Georgia / Kazakhstan 2–3 months Compact cycle, fast transition between examinations and treatment, relatively lower PGT application rate

The above are common clinical pathway references. Actual duration depends on individual plans and clinic scheduling.

Timeline Planning Reference for Different Groups

Scenario 1: Under 35 years old, normal ovarian function

AMH 2.5–5.0 ng/mL, AFC 12–20, no chromosomal abnormalities. Using a conventional antagonist protocol, without PGT.

  • Preliminary preparation: 4–5 weeks (including waiting for chromosomal report)
  • Stimulation + egg retrieval: ~2 weeks
  • Embryo culture + fresh transfer: ~1 week
  • Total duration: approximately 7–9 weeks (from starting examinations to pregnancy test)

Scenario 2: Over 38 years old, low AMH (0.8–1.5 ng/mL)

May require multiple stimulation cycles to accumulate embryos, or PGT-A screening.

  • First stimulation + egg retrieval: ~3 weeks
  • Embryo culture + PGT testing: ~4 weeks
  • If a second stimulation is needed: interval of 1–2 menstrual cycles
  • Frozen embryo transfer preparation: ~3 weeks
  • Total duration: typically 4–6 months

Scenario 3: History of recurrent implantation failure or miscarriage

Requires additional hysteroscopy, immunological evaluation, or genetic counseling.

  • Hysteroscopy + pathology report: 2–3 weeks
  • Complete immunological testing: 2–4 weeks
  • Genetic counseling + PGT testing: 4–6 weeks
  • Total duration: mostly 5–7 months, needs to be completed in stages

How many trips abroad are needed? How long is each stay?

In most cases, 2–3 trips abroad are required:

  • First trip: File creation + some examinations + stimulation and egg retrieval (stay 10–14 days)
  • Second trip: Embryo transfer (stay 5–7 days, if frozen embryo transfer)
  • Third trip: If follow-up or transfer of remaining embryos is needed, stay about 3–5 days

If choosing a fresh transfer, you stay locally after egg retrieval until the pregnancy test after transfer, with a total stay of about 3–4 weeks.

Does the male partner need to accompany throughout?

The male partner must be present at the clinic on the day of egg retrieval to provide a semen sample. If using frozen sperm or testicular sperm aspiration, the male partner can return home after providing the sample earlier. Some countries require the male partner to be present during the initial file creation.

Can I still do overseas IVF with low AMH? Will it take longer?

Low AMH does not mean it’s impossible, but it may require multiple cycles to accumulate embryos, extending the total duration to 6–12 months. It is recommended to discuss embryo accumulation strategies with a reproductive doctor in advance and assess ovarian response.

Timeline Planning Reminder

⏳ Key Reminder: The overall duration of overseas IVF is not necessarily better when shorter. Deliberately compressing examination or preparation time may increase the cycle cancellation rate or affect embryo quality. It is recommended to reserve a complete window of at least 4–6 months to accommodate examination delays, embryo testing results, or endometrial preparation adjustments. Before departure, be sure to check the examination checklist, document validity, and lab schedule item by item with your coordinator to avoid trip interruptions due to information mismatches.
